Uncover Telluride's Cultural and Arts Scene

Telluride offers more than just outdoor adventures; it also showcases a dynamic arts and culture environment that enhances the local community atmosphere. The town hosts a variety of galleries displaying works from local and regional artists, with pieces that capture the breathtaking scenery and deep history of the region. The Telluride Art Walk, a monthly event, welcomes visitors to tour these galleries while connecting with artists and experiencing live music.

In addition, the Telluride Film Festival, a renowned event, attracts directors and film enthusiasts from across the globe, celebrating independent film and the art of storytelling. The community's rich architectural heritage and scenic streets offer a beautiful backdrop for community gatherings, including shows at the Sheridan Opera House and the Telluride Conference Center.

Throughout the year, Telluride's artistic community fosters artistic growth and communal bonds, making it a fundamental part of the town's identity. Guests can explore this diverse artistic environment, elevating their visit.

Activities for Every Season: Your Year-Round Guide

What is the best way to fully enjoy the beauty of Telluride year-round? This picturesque mountain town boasts an impressive selection of seasonal activities that are designed for outdoor enthusiasts and leisure travelers alike. When winter arrives, visitors can enjoy exceptional ski and snowboard adventures on the slopes of the Telluride Ski Resort. As snow melts, spring showcases vibrant wildflowers, making it the ideal season for trail hiking and mountain biking on scenic trails.

Summertime presents numerous festivals and outdoor activities, including fishing, rafting, and horseback riding, enabling guests to enjoy the warm sunshine alongside stunning vistas. When fall sets in, the colorful foliage offers a magnificent canvas for hiking and photography, with opportunities for scenic drives along the San Juan Skyway. Telluride's every season delivers one-of-a-kind experiences, making certain that each visitor can uncover their own excitement or serene escape in this Colorado jewel.

Iconic Local Dishes

Rooted in the diverse food culture influenced by farm-to-table traditions, beloved local flavors in Telluride embody the town's unique flavors and heritage. Food lovers can indulge in the famous elk burger at The Last Dollar Saloon, where regionally harvested ingredients elevate this hearty favorite. The charming establishment, Allred's, offers breathtaking views alongside its signature wild game stew, presenting a blend of classic and modern flavors. For dessert enthusiasts, the Telluride Truffle provides artisan handmade chocolates, wonderful for savoring after a day of outdoor activity. The town's thriving food scene additionally highlights the popular corn chowder at The Butcher & Baker Café, making it a must-try for those who love hearty fare. Each dish tells a story of Telluride's rich cultural tapestry and commitment to excellence.

When Is the Perfect Time to Head to Telluride for Skiing?

The optimal time to travel to Telluride for skiing is usually from December through early April. During this period, visitors can anticipate prime snow conditions and an array of seasonal activities, elevating their entire experience.

How Can I Get to Telluride From the Closest Airport?

When traveling to Telluride from the nearest airport, most travelers choose to fly into Montrose Regional Airport. From there, they can rent a car or take a shuttle service, providing a picturesque journey of roughly 1.5 hours.
